Dates and Deadlines
Academic Calendar by Term
Each term at Cal State Monterey Bay comes with key deadlines for registration, payments, course changes and more. Use this page to find the dates you need to know to avoid late fees, stay enrolled, and make informed decisions about your academic progress. Deadlines apply to new students, continuing students, and those preparing to graduate. Be sure to review your term and add key dates to your calendar.
